In the Military, you are told to "Use your Chain of Command" regarding any problem, including disputes of harassment. But sometimes the problem IS your Chain of Command. Any attempt at involving an uninvolved party is seen as "jumping the Chain" and also results in punishment when your superior retaliates. This is a cycle of abuse where the bully is the ultimate authority as to whether or not they are being a bully. Stop allowing higher ranking people to be the only deciding factor as to whether a complaint has merit solely because of rank structure. Take the power out of the hands of the bully by giving lower ranking people their voice back. Make the Equal Opportunity Manager a group of different ranking people outside of the command and not just another member of the bully's peer group.
